'End of the Hunt' episode #162
Reef Jackson shot Lucas in the back 10 years prior, happening when Margaret was still alive and Lucas still living back in the Nations (Enid). Reef is Granny Meade's nephew. She lived in Enid because she remembered the fight they had while digging a ditch when they were growing up. How is it that Granny Meade is now living in North Fork? Thanks Bluewindfarm!
John Gilbert played the boy who came to tell Lucas that Granny Mede's kin was at her place.
John is the son of Herschel Burke Gilbert
